Superior Insulation and Thermal Performance

  • Advanced Glass Technology: Polar Seal windows utilize advanced glass technology that reduces heat transfer, keeping your home warmer in the winter and cooler in the summer. This means less reliance on heating and cooling systems, which translates to lower energy consumption.
  • Multi-Chambered Frames: The frames of Polar Seal windows are engineered with multiple chambers that trap air, providing an additional layer of insulation. This design helps to minimize thermal bridging, further enhancing the window’s insulating properties.

Choosing the Right Glass for Maximum Energy Efficiency

When considering Polar Seal windows for your home in Taylor, MI, it’s important to understand the different types of glass available and their impact on energy efficiency. The type of glass you choose can significantly affect how well your windows insulate your home, ultimately influencing your energy bills and comfort.

One essential factor to consider is the glass’s ability to reduce heat transfer. Low-emissivity (Low-E) glass is a popular option for homeowners looking to enhance energy efficiency. This type of glass is coated with a thin, transparent layer that reflects infrared energy (heat) while allowing visible light to pass through. During the cold Michigan winters, Low-E glass helps retain heat inside your home, while in the summer, it reflects heat away, keeping your interiors cooler.

Another consideration is the number of panes in your windows. Double-pane windows offer a balance of energy efficiency and cost-effectiveness by trapping air between two layers of glass, which acts as an insulating barrier. For even greater efficiency, triple-pane windows are an option, providing additional insulation and noise reduction, making them ideal for homes in busy areas of Taylor.

Argon or krypton gas fills are also worth exploring. These inert gases are denser than air and are used between the panes to further reduce heat transfer. While krypton offers slightly better insulation, argon is a more cost-effective choice and still significantly improves energy performance.

In summary, selecting the right combination of glass type, number of panes, and gas fill can greatly enhance the energy efficiency of your Polar Seal windows. Key Terms for Understanding Polar Seal Window Energy Efficiency

When considering the installation of Polar Seal windows to enhance energy efficiency in your Taylor, MI home, it’s helpful to familiarize yourself with some industry terms. These definitions will provide clarity as you explore your options and make informed decisions.

Term Plain-language meaning
U-factor Measures how well a window prevents heat from escaping; lower numbers mean better insulation.
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) Indicates how well a window blocks heat from sunlight; lower values mean less heat enters your home.
Low-E Glass Glass coated to reflect heat while allowing light to pass through, improving insulation.
R-value A measure of thermal resistance; higher values signify better insulation.
Argon Gas Fill Gas used between window panes to reduce heat transfer and improve insulation.
Double Glazing Windows with two panes of glass, providing better insulation than single-pane windows.
Energy Star Certification A label indicating that a product meets energy efficiency guidelines set by the U.S. EPA.
